July 11, 2008, Newsletter Issue #70: Turn Old Greeting Cards into New Postcards

Tip of the Week

We buy greeting cards for so many occasions and als receive them throughout the year. You may have tons of greeting cards from years gone by for a variety of different holidays and occasions. You can use those old greeting cards for your card sending occasions!

Carefully cut the front panel from the old greeting card you would like to use. With a ruler and a fine tip black marker, draw a line down the horizontal center of the card. Now you have a postcard! Use one side of the card for your address, postage stamp small drawings or embellishments and the other side for your message.

This is a great way to recycle and reuse, while saving you money on greeting cards! It takes very little time to convert a greeting card into a post card, but once you're finished you have a one of a kind postcard that the recipient can cherish and enjoy for years to come!
